Transaction 25dca3e920a953b22d20e84b7845c739fe784da2f985cd70b79919f786be7550
2 Input
2 Outputs
- 25dca3e920a953b22d20e84b7845c739fe784da2f985cd70b79919f786be7550:0
- 25dca3e920a953b22d20e84b7845c739fe784da2f985cd70b79919f786be7550:1
value 21608897
address 3CWHGTWpQvpcr37SM5vB6KzJa6wpQpgcwy
value 54844322
address 1CKUUKqxuwcSRoyhbXuN1dYPcpkHKVqg3r